zabbix修改/忘记密码

本文介绍如何在Zabbix中进行密码修改和语言设置,包括通过web界面修改管理员密码和选择中文界面的方法,同时也提供了当忘记Admin密码时,如何使用MySQL命令行工具重置密码的详细步骤。

修改密码

点击 Administration -> Users -> Admin -> Password
再修改密码:cnhope
修改中文
Administration -> Users -> Admin ->Language
选:Chinese(zh_CN)

user
首页

忘记Admin密码

mysql -uroot -pcnhope
show databases;
use zabbix
update users set passwd=md5(‘newpasswd’) where alias=‘Admin’;
desc users; #查看user表字段
select * from users;

### 解决Zabbix MySQL权限不足问题 当遇到`permission denied /var/lib/mysql/bin/mysql`错误时,这通常意味着运行中的进程无法访问所需的MySQL资源。对于Zabbix环境而言,确保容器化部署下的适当权限设置至关重要。 在Docker环境中启动Zabbix Proxy并连接到MySQL数据库的过程中,如果出现权限被拒绝的情况,可以考虑以下几个方面来解决问题: #### 容器特权模式 使用`--privileged`参数虽然赋予了较高的权限级别,但这并不是最佳实践[^1]。更好的方法是指定具体的设备映射或者调整SELinux策略(如果是基于RHEL/CentOS系统)。然而,在某些情况下确实需要更高的权限才能正常工作,则应评估安全风险后再做决定。 #### 文件系统挂载选项 确认宿主机上的数据卷是否正确配置,并且具有足够的读写权限给到目标容器。特别是涉及到/var/lib/mysql路径的时候,因为这是默认存储InnoDB表空间的位置之一。可以通过如下方式指定volume mount: ```bash -v /path/on/host:/var/lib/mysql \ ``` 同时要保证该目录及其子文件夹拥有合适的属组和权限位,例如750或更严格一点640,具体取决于实际需求。 #### 用户身份验证与授权 检查用于建立连接的用户名密码组合是否有效;另外还要核实此账户是否有权执行必要的操作于所选database之上(`GRANT ALL PRIVILEGES ON zabbix.* TO 'zabbix'@'%' IDENTIFIED BY 'yourpassword';`)。最后不要忘记刷新权限以使更改生效 (`FLUSH PRIVILEGES;`)。 通过上述措施应该能够缓解大部分由于权限不够而导致的问题。当然也建议查看官方文档获取更多关于安全性方面的指导信息。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值